The postcode AL8 7RA is located in Welwyn Hatfield, in the county of Hertfordsh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. AL8 7RA is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

AL8 7RA is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of AL8 7RA as Hard-pressed living > Migration and churn > Hard-pressed ethnic mix.

The closest road name to AL8 7RA is Oakdale which is centered 72 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Oakdale and is 84 m away. The closest railway station is Welwyn North Rail Station, 1.3 km away.

The closest primary school to AL8 7RA (for ages 11 and under) is Homerswood Primary and Nursery School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on January 23,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Monk's Walk School. The last OFSTED inspection on February 6, 2018 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of AL8 7RA is The Hopfields and is 5.15 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 12,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Kersey Guitars and is 5.03 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as AwaitingInspection .

Residents reported an average download speed of 208.4 Mbps and an average upload speed of 20.6 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for AL8 7RA is covered by the Hertfordshire police force association and Hertfordsh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
